QUALITY AND RISK MANAGEMENT. In order to help ensure continued employee and patient safety and quality of care:  Staff are required to participate in the development and maintenance of a quality service through the application of professional standards; participation in quality improvement activities; and compliance with the policies, procedures, practices and organisational goals and objectives of AWH.  Staff are required to contribute to the development and maintenance of the AWH Risk Management Framework and apply the framework to identify, evaluate and minimise exposure to risk across the organisation.  A positive risk culture at AWH is embedded by our belief that everyone has a role in risk. You are encouraged to identify opportunities for improvement and play a role in assisting the organisation to achieve its risk objectives.  Staff are required to abide by the Code of Conduct for AWH.
